The cement industry is responsible for a significant amount of global CO2 emissions, accounting for about 8% of the world’s total carbon dioxide output. Incorporating carbon-capture technologies into cement production can not only help reduce these emissions but also create new business opportunities for cement manufacturers.
1. Reducing Environmental Impact:
One of the primary benefits of implementing carbon-capture technologies in cement production is the significant reduction in greenhouse gas emissions. By capturing and storing CO2 emissions, cement plants can minimize their environmental impact and contribute to global efforts to combat climate change.
2. Meeting Regulatory Requirements:
As governments around the world implement more stringent regulations to limit carbon emissions, cement manufacturers must find ways to comply with these requirements. Adopting carbon-capture technologies can help cement plants meet regulatory standards and avoid potential fines or penalties.
3. Enhancing Corporate Sustainability:
Incorporating carbon-capture technologies can also enhance a cement company’s corporate sustainability credentials. By demonstrating a commitment to reducing carbon emissions, cement manufacturers can attract environmentally conscious customers and investors who prioritize sustainability.
4. Creating Revenue Streams:
Implementing carbon-capture technologies presents opportunities for cement companies to create new revenue streams. For example, capturing CO2 emissions and selling them for use in other industries, such as the production of synthetic fuels or chemicals, can generate additional income for cement manufacturers.
